For the sake of knowledge and discussion, I thought it would be a fun idea to start a thread based on builds that we like to fight and like to play, as well as hate to fight and hate to play.

If we describe things that give us difficulty, others who are more experienced can give tips on how to improve.

For example, I like to fight condition Mesmers when on my Warrior. Probably for obvious reasons but I find the fights very enjoyable because they tend to last quite a while and it can be a tug of war at times. I’ll get low then they’ll get low and it gets the heart racing.

I dislike fighting bunker Druids because they’re incredibly difficult to kill unless you have respectable access to CC’s and are very wise about timing their usage. I find it extremely unenjoyable to fight these builds as their reset potential is about as high, if not higher than a Thief’s and it feels like I’m putting way more effort in to the fight than they are.

Playing as a Condi Necro, I find Thieves and Warriors as the worst match-ups, with equal skill it’s usually a win for them, but I still find the Thief being the bigger thorn in my shoes, because of their mobility and reset potential is just too annoying to deal with as a Necro, at least with a condi build. Burst Mesmers can also be very dangerous but thankfully they’re not as common.

Surprisingly, it’s usually a favorable match-up against every other profession with a natural tendency to counter condi builds which is what necro is godly at. Still, good Scrappers can give me a run for my money and some Druids are exceptionally difficult to beat, Dragonhunters are also becoming a threat due to the recent buffs and can put out a lot of pressure. Revs are usually a free kill unless they manage to pressure me enough and deal with my condi burst with their well timed heal and cleanse (Mallyx can somehow give them a slight edge if they have enough boons to cover their resistance but I run traited signets and traited spinal shivers so it’s usually not an issue for me).

I tend to avoid solo roaming as Necro because its mobility makes it very difficult to juke large groups running in your way or other havoc groups looking for fights, so I usually run with at least anoter guildie or two and that’s where I see Necro being a genuine threat, what they lack in sheer mobility, they make it up in fighting prowess with the right tools.

If you’re squishy and the Thief is squishy, it’s all about denying those sneak attacks and counter pressuring their heals. As soon as they Withdraw or Channeled Vigor, lay the damage in to them immediately after. When I had an Engineer, I found it was effective to respond to their stealth with my own stealth by using a Toss Elixir S followed by a Magnet as soon as they became visible again.

Also, when a Thief retreats, you should too. Don’t chase them, back off and recover. Let them decide if they want to come back to re-engage you. You know they’re there and you’ll see them coming which means they won’t have the advantage of a surprise attack.

Thieves are a lot less scary when you show them that you’re not falling for their baits and kites. If you teach them that you’re the one in control of the fight, most of them will stubbornly buzz around you like a fly until they push their luck too far. It’s the ones that know they have limits that you should be afraid of. The ones that know when they’re beat so they disengage completely until they can jump you when you’re not prepared.

It’s not that thieves are particularly overpowered. They’re not. It’s just an unfair fight.

If I screw up and take too much damage, I will die. The thief can catch up because their mobility is 3x as good as any other class. If the thief screws up and takes too much damage, they stealth or escape out of range. In order for me to win, I need to kill the thief in one burst. The thief can just keep resetting until they eventually catch me off guard.

Dislike playing as and fighting against Staff Druid. I think it’s because the relative effort you have to put in to kill the Druid compared to what the Druid has to do is enormous. I just can’t bear to use staff in any of my builds anymore.

Also dislike fighting and playing as D/P thieves because it really is overtuned. So much damage just from basically auto-attacking and shadow shotting. Just nothing like the class I once enjoyed.

Like playing as and fighting against interrupt Mesmer because it’s one of the last things in the game that feels like it requires some effort from the player. When I win on an interrupt build I actually feel like it’s because of something I did rather than just because of certain traits I happen to have. Fighting against a decent interrupt Mesmer is a joy because it takes some decent knowledge (at least for GW2) to know what types of interrupts should be used and what key skills must be interrupted to succeed.
